2081 Ballan-Meredith Road, Ballan 
$1.3 million-plus
4 bedrooms 2 bathrooms

Only an hour from Melbourne, this  57-hectare property offers much appeal and potential. The historic weatherboard homestead has a classic double-fronted facade with a welcoming shady verandah. A recent renovation and extension has created a smart contemporary interior with plenty of space. There is a formal living room and separate formal dining room, a smart country-style kitchen and a clever enclosed sunroom. The house is built around a courtyard, the central feature of which is a solar-heated pool, enclosed by a hedge. The gardens are a key feature here; there’s an orchard, rose garden, formal hedged gardens and plenty of established trees. Beyond the home garden, there are nine main paddocks with smaller paddocks. A huge dam provides water for stock and there’s a small shearing shed. It all adds up to the possibility of many agricultural activities, as well as a very comfortable lifestyle 15 kilometres south of Ballan.
